ubuntu

Ubuntu中如何解决PyTorch错误

小樊
39
2025-05-22 07:15:58
栏目: 智能运维

在Ubuntu中解决PyTorch错误通常涉及几个关键步骤,包括安装必要的依赖项、配置CUDA和cuDNN、以及使用正确的安装命令。以下是一些常见的解决方案和步骤:

安装依赖项

确保你已经安装了所有必要的依赖项,包括Anaconda、CUDA和cuDNN。

使用Conda安装PyTorch

使用Conda安装PyTorch是一个常见的方法,因为它可以自动处理依赖关系。首先,创建一个新的Conda环境:

conda create -n pytorch_env python=3.8
conda activate pytorch_env

然后,根据你的CUDA版本,使用以下命令安装PyTorch。例如,如果你的CUDA版本是11.3,你可以使用:

conda install pytorch torchvision torchaudio cudatoolkit=11.3 -c pytorch -c nvidia

使用pip安装PyTorch

如果你选择使用pip安装PyTorch,确保你已经安装了所有必要的构建工具和CUDA库:

sudo apt-get update
sudo apt-get install -y build-essential libssl-dev libffi-dev python3-dev

然后,你可以使用PyTorch的官方pip安装命令来安装特定版本的PyTorch。例如,对于CUDA 11.3:

pip install torch torchvision torchaudio --extra-index-url https://download.pytorch.org/whl/cu113

解决常见错误

验证安装

安装完成后,你可以通过以下命令验证PyTorch是否安装成功:

import torch
print(torch.__version__)
print(torch.cuda.is_available())

如果torch.cuda.is_available()返回True,则说明PyTorch已经正确安装并可以使用GPU。

请注意,具体步骤可能会根据你的Ubuntu版本、CUDA版本以及PyTorch版本有所不同。建议参考PyTorch的官方文档以获取最准确的安装指南。

0
看了该问题的人还看了